Soruyu burda anlatmak zor olduğundan zipli olarak gönderiy

Levent Menteşoğlu

Administrator
Yönetici
Admin
Katılım
13 Ekim 2004
Mesajlar
16,056
Excel Vers. ve Dili
Excel 2010-32 bit-Türkçe
Excel 365 -32 bit-Türkçe
makro1 e aşağıdaki ilaveyi yapın.
[vb:1:4141116603]If [b3] = 0 Then
......mevcut kodlarınız
End If
[/vb:1:4141116603]
makro2ye de
[vb:1:4141116603]If [b3] <> 0 Then
......mevcut kodlarınız
End If
[/vb:1:4141116603]

Not:Size bir soru başlığı önereyim
"B3 hücresi boş ise makro1i,dolu ise makro2yi nasıl çalıştırırım"
 
Katılım
29 Eylül 2004
Mesajlar
1,810
Excel Vers. ve Dili
Excel 2002 TR
Sn. ozgurmath
Cevap aldınız ama imzamın yanındaki Forum Kuralları ve tavsiyelerini bir okurmusunuz. Hangilerine uymadınız tahmin edin bakalım.


Alt kısım sizinle ilgili değil sn.ozgurmath; yeri geldiği için tüm arkadaşlara;
(Gerçi o başlığın 3700 üyesi olan bir forumda sadece 500-600 kere okunmuş olması pek çok arkadaşımızın onlara yardım etmeye çalışan diğer kişilere saygı göstermeyi pekde umursamadığını gösteriyor.)
 
Katılım
11 Temmuz 2004
Mesajlar
43
İyi akşamlar arkadaşlar;

Hatamı biliyorum.Bir daha olmaması için elimden geleni yapacağım.Uygun biçimde tanımlama yapmak ya da soru sormak bazen mümkün olmayabiliyor.

İlginizden ötürü teşekkür ederim.İyi çalışmalar.
 
Katılım
11 Temmuz 2004
Mesajlar
43
Merhaba sayın leventm;

Verdiğiniz kodlar ancak bir tuş yardımıyla işe yarıyor.Ben ise şunun olmasını istiyorum:

B3 hücresi dolu olduğunda ya da boş olduğunda makrolar otomatik olarak çalışsın.
Herhalde sayfanın kod yapısına bir şeyler yazılacak ama bir türlü beceremiyorum.Herhalde acemiliğimden olsa gerek...

İyi akşamlar...
 
Katılım
29 Eylül 2004
Mesajlar
1,810
Excel Vers. ve Dili
Excel 2002 TR
Þu an dosyanızı indiremiyorum. (Bağlantımda sorun olduğu için aşırı yavaş)

Þöyle deneyin;

Sayfa modülünde Worksheet_Change altında
If [b3] = 0 Then
call makro1
End If

If [b3] <> 0 Then
call makro2
End If
 
Katılım
11 Temmuz 2004
Mesajlar
43
Merhabalar;

Kodlar aradığımdı.teşekkürler.İyi çalışmalar.
 
Üst